While existing majors adequately serve most students, certain individuals have academic pursuits that don't align with current programs or conventional academic boundaries. The School of Liberal Arts' Individualized Major Program (IMP) caters to these students. It's designed for dedicated, independent learners seeking to explore traditional disciplines or interdisciplinary fields not currently offered at IUPUI, as well as those wishing to create custom interdisciplinary majors tailored to their personal experiences, interests, and goals. The IMP also accommodates transfer students looking to continue specialized studies in areas where IUPUI has faculty knowledge but no formal degree program.
For those passionate about deeply studying multiple disciplines across the curriculum, a customized individualized major might be the perfect solution.
Choosing an individualized major enables you to integrate diverse interests into a unified academic plan that represents your unique identity. You'll collaborate with an advisor and faculty to develop your specialized course of study - essentially crafting your own professional journey.

ENGLISH PROFICIENCY REQUIREMENTS
Students scoring TOEFL 60+ or IELTS 5.5+ are eligible for admission but should anticipate taking additional English for Academic Purposes courses along with their academic program.
